# Telemetry client setup — Packrat compressor path.
# All outbound telemetry must go through the Packrat sidecar, which
# applies zstd level 6 before shipping to the Cinderline ingest API.
# Do NOT send raw payloads; ingest rejects anything over 256 KB
# uncompressed. Batch window is 5s, flush on shutdown is mandatory.
# The client needs the ingest endpoint from config/cinderline.yaml
# and a service key with telemetry:write scope. Keys rotate monthly
# via the Hollowforge job. The current ingest key is below.

gateway credential: kto3_qfe

TICKET: Weather-alert fan-out dropping regional subscribers

Since the Stormline ingest upgrade, the fan-out worker in Gullwind occasionally skips subscribers in the Merrow Coast region when alert batches exceed 500 entries. Duplicate suppression appears to trim valid recipients. To reproduce, replay a batch from the staging queue with the regional flag set and compare delivery counts. The regression was first seen in the build identified by the token below.

trace token, kahog-tajeg: htk6_97d963

**Build provenance: Tidewhisk branch-cleanup bot**

Tidewhisk deletes branches stale for 90 days on the Marrowfield monorepo. Before acting on any deletion complaint, confirm which bot build performed the sweep — behavior around protected-branch globs changed between releases. Provenance is stamped into every sweep log header. The currently deployed build is identified by the token directly below.

session token of tajef-bageg = htk21_5d90d574934f3ccae6437